Runtime binding for greengrass:ResolveComponentCandidates.
Resolves a set of component candidates against a target platform,
returning the exact component versions (and their recipes) that satisfy
the version requirements — the same dependency-resolution API the
Greengrass nucleus calls during a deployment. Provide the implementation
with Effect.provide(AWS.GreengrassV2.ResolveComponentCandidatesHttp).
NOTE: per the AWS API reference, this operation must be called through the
Greengrass data plane endpoint authenticated with an AWS IoT device
certificate. Calls signed with plain IAM credentials (e.g. from a Lambda
role) are rejected with a typed AccessDeniedException even when the
greengrass:ResolveComponentCandidates permission is granted — use this
binding only from device-credentialed contexts.
Reading Components
Section titled “Reading Components”// init — account-level binding, no resource argumentconst resolveComponentCandidates = yield* AWS.GreengrassV2.ResolveComponentCandidates();
// runtimeconst { resolvedComponentVersions } = yield* resolveComponentCandidates({ platform: { attributes: { os: "linux", architecture: "amd64" } }, componentCandidates: [ { componentName: "com.example.Hello", versionRequirements: { req: ">=1.0.0" } }, ],});
